Dreamstation.cc: Jumper: Griffin's Story Review

Jumper: Griffin's Story will be fun for only the first hour or two; luckily this game is only about twice as long. Dreamstation.cc recommend renting this game if you are looking for achievement points. Dreamstation.cc wouldn't expect a whole lot of fun from it though. (Jumper: Griffin's Story, Xbox 360) 4/10
